1 Kings 14:3-4
New American Standard Bible
Chapter 14
3
Take ten loaves with you,
some
pastries, and a jar of honey, and go to him. He will tell you what will happen to the boy.'
4
And Jeroboam’s wife did so, and set out and went to Shiloh, and came to the house of Ahijah. Now Ahijah could not see because his eyes were glossy from his old age.
King James Version
Chapter 14
3
And take with thee ten loaves, and cracknels, and a cruse of honey, and go to him: he shall tell thee what shall become of the child.
4
And Jeroboam's wife did so, and arose, and went to Shiloh, and came to the house of Ahijah. But Ahijah could not see; for his eyes were set by reason of his age.
